GENERAOT GOVERNMENT GAZETTE

A Gbniril Government Gazette, issued on the 7th instant, contains the warrant, under the Royal ■ign manual, under which the decoration of the Vie. toria Cross may be conferred on persons serving in colonial force* ; despatch from Lord Carnarvon notifying that her Majwtyhad signified her intention of conferrine; the Cross upon Major Heaphy ; and letter from Colonel Haultain, by direction of the Governor, congratulating Major Heapby upon the illustrious distinction he had deservedly earned. The appointment of the Hons. J. C. Richmond and W. Fitzherbert to be Commissioners under the Stamp Duties Act. A warning to all Government servants not to give any information relating to public business, directly or indirectly, to the Press, or any one out of the Btrict course of business. Notifications of the elections of Messrs. H. S. Harrison, P. Dignan, and H. A. Atkinson to the House of Repreientatives. Tenders are called for the performance of the iuterprovincial steam mail services on the East Coaab for six months from the Ist July next. The Gazette also contains notice to mariners relative to Port Natal lighthouse j Supreme Court notices ; and statement of L. OBrien, Esq., Registrar of the Supreme Court, in account with the estate of Thomas Luck, deceased, intestate.
